How IP67 security Enhances dependability in Outdoor apps
The IP67 defense ranking of M12 water-proof connectors contributes appreciably to their dependability in outdoor purposes. IP67 implies that the connector is totally guarded from dust ingress and may endure immersion in h2o as many as 1 meter for half-hour. This helps make them suitable for purposes where by they may be subjected to splashes, rain, or maybe non permanent submersion. Such robust security is particularly valuable in sectors like development and transportation, where devices and methods will often be subjected to complicated climatic conditions. For example, these connectors are commonly Utilized in outdoor lights techniques and electronic signage to ensure uninterrupted Procedure in spite of environmental variables. They're built with threaded locking mechanisms that safe business connectivity, decreasing the chance of disconnection resulting from vibrations or actions.

variances among M12 A-Coded and D-Coded Connectors
comprehension the distinctions among M12 A-coded and D-coded connectors can help in picking out the proper just one for particular programs. M12 A-coded connectors are historically used for ability provide and easy sign transmission programs which include connecting sensors and actuators. They typically have two to 12 pins and therefore are highly flexible throughout several fields. On the flip side, M12 D-coded connectors are generally created for details transmission purposes with speeds up to one hundred Mbps, building them specifically suitable for Ethernet and fieldbus methods. Their four-pin configuration ensures reliable communication in facts-intensive environments, for example clever factories and complicated automation devices. The specific coding of such connectors also can help avoid mismatched connections, which might disrupt method operations.
